Frequently Asked Questions: Data Scientist in San Francisco

What is the average Data Scientist salary in San Francisco?

The median base salary for a Data Scientist in San Francisco, California is $196,000 per year ($16,333/month). Entry-level roles start around $120,500, while senior and staff-level professionals earn up to $309,500.

How does San Francisco Data Scientist pay compare to the national average?

Data Scientist salaries in San Francisco are 42% above the U.S. national benchmark of $138,000.

What is the estimated monthly take-home pay for a Data Scientist in San Francisco?

At the median salary of $196,000, the estimated monthly net take-home pay in San Francisco is approximately $11,058 after deducting estimated federal taxes ($3,757/mo) and state/local taxes ($1,519/mo).

Is San Francisco affordable for a Data Scientist?

With an average 1-bedroom rent of $3,100/month, housing consumes approximately 28% of a Data Scientist's estimated net take-home pay, which is well within the recommended 30% financial guideline.
